Conversations with a diverse range of guests, including comedians, filmmakers, sports figures, and authors, are a hallmark of this show, covering their personal journeys and insights. Episodes often feature discussions on unique storytelling, humor, and creative processes, making for engaging and sometimes humorous listening experiences. Highlights include reflections on careers, the entertainment industry, and the intersection of comedy with various aspects of life. The podcast distinctly combines humor with thought-provoking exchanges, appealing to listeners who enjoy in-depth interviews with varied personalities.
